Half-Time Report: Charlton Athletic lead Brighton & Hove Albion by two goals

Charlton score twice in the opening six minutes to lead Brighton & Hove Albion 2-0, as the visitors' unbeaten start to the season is put in serious jeopardy.

Charlton Athletic have scored twice in the opening six minutes to put Brighton & Hove Albion's unbeaten season to the test.

Charlton took the lead when Ricardo Vaz Te supplied Reza Ghoochannejhad with the ball, who fed Ademola Lookman.

The teenager beat Bruno Manga in the box before firing past David Stockdale to give Charlton the lead with just two minutes played.

Karel Fraeye's men doubled their lead in the sixth minute as Johann Gudmundsson whipped in a cross from the left.

The ball just evaded Vaz Te in the centre of the box but Ghoochannejhad was on hand at the back post to sweep home.

The Addicks were on the attack again moments later as Ghoochannejhad popped up once more at the far post, his header from Vaz Te's cross somehow kept out by Stockdale.

A clash of heads between Solomon March and debutant Harry Lennon midway through the half saw the latter forced off due to a gash on his forehead.

The Bluebirds had Stockdale to thank once more as the stopper made another save, this time from a point-blank 30th-minute Gudmundsson effort.

In the seventh minute of injury time, Charlton again went close as another Stockdale stop denied Lookman his brace.
